Here's a 2000 Epiphone Dot (ES-335 type) semi-hollowbody in unbelievable shape for its age and with multiple upgrades. Made in the Un Sung factory in Korea. The stock pickups have been replaced with a Duncan SH-2 Jazz at the neck and SH-4 JB at the bridge. Additionally, I completely re-did the controls with push-pull pots & speed knobs all around. Both humbuckers can be coil-split, they can be run out of phase a la Peter Green, or they can be run in series with each other for a huge, fat tone. The tuners are the best I've ever run into on an inexpensive guitar. The neck is fairly thick, but not a "baseball bat", by any means, and has a nice dark rosewood fingerboard. The guitar plays very well and sounds just great. The neck pickup is perfect for round jazzy tones with the tone rolled down, or a fat, bluesy sound with the treble up and some gain on the amp. The JB bridge pickup just flat screams when cranked up, but also has a nice, biting clean tone without sounding harsh. Comes with the original hardshell case. $350 + shipping to the US or Canada.
